Speed-Injected Technology
At the heart of the M6 driver is its Speed-Injected Technology. This means that the clubface is optimized to deliver maximum speed while adhering to the legal limits set by the USGA. Think of it as fine-tuning your favorite music playlist to ensure that each note comes through just right. Whether you hit it flush or slightly off-center, the M6 compensates to maintain that precious distance you’re chasing.
Twist Face Technology
Next up is the Twist Face Technology, which is like having a personal coach right in your driver. This innovative feature is designed to correct mis-hits, enhancing forgiveness when you don’t hit the sweet spot. By slightly angling the face, the M6 helps to reduce side spin, which in turn minimizes those wicked hooks and slices. If you’ve ever felt the frustration of watching your ball veer off course, you’ll appreciate how this technology works quietly in the background to keep things straight and true.
Adjustable Weighting System
The adjustable weighting system on the M6 is another game-changer. With this feature, high handicappers have the flexibility to fine-tune their shot shape. Want to promote a draw? Shift the weight. Prefer a fade? No problem! This customization empowers golfers by letting them adapt the club to their unique swing, making it feel like it was specifically designed for them.

What makes the TaylorMade M6 Driver suitable for high handicappers?
The TaylorMade M6 Driver was specifically designed to help players with higher handicaps improve their game. One of its standout features is the Twist Face technology, which promotes better ball flight and more consistent strikes. This technology is engineered to correct off-center hits by optimizing the face’s curvature, allowing errant shots to find the fairway more often. This means that high handicappers, who may struggle with accuracy, can experience a more forgiving driver.
Additionally, the M6 Driver features a high launch angle and low spin rates, which are crucial for maximizing distance. High handicappers typically benefit from equipment that allows them to hit the ball further without sacrificing control. With a larger face area and a lightweight construction, the M6 enables faster swing speeds and greater distance, all while providing a confidence-inspiring look at address.

What are the customization options available with the TaylorMade M6 Driver?
The TaylorMade M6 Driver offers several customization options, which are particularly advantageous for high handicappers who may be still developing their preferences. Golfers can adjust the loft and lie angles to suit their swing style. This flexibility allows players to find the optimal settings that promote better launch conditions and improve overall performance.
Additionally, the M6 comes with various shaft options that differ in flex and weight. Choosing the right shaft can have a significant impact on the ball flight and distance. High handicappers can experiment with different combinations through a custom fitting session, which many golf shops offer. This personal touch can lead to tailored performance that enhances confidence and playability.

What are the potential downsides of the TaylorMade M6 Driver for high handicappers?
While the TaylorMade M6 Driver offers numerous advantages, there are a few potential downsides that high handicappers should keep in mind. One concern is the price point; the M6 is relatively expensive compared to entry-level drivers. For those new to the sport or on a budget, this could be a deterrent, though many users argue that the investment is worthwhile for the performance benefits.
Another consideration is that even with a forgiving design, the M6 might not resolve all swing issues. High handicappers still need to invest time in improving their technique. Relying solely on technology can lead to complacency without focused practice and training. Therefore, combining the M6 Driver with coaching or constructive practice routines is vital to capitalize on its technological advantages effectively.
